Output ec8b51d54a63626f968a8b91e22354063bc90ff9d1d66db47eacc8c9a4bf76d2:2

value
1516156
script pubkey
OP_0 OP_PUSHBYTES_20 58e6b5c8ddc83d65a26bd238e40a73243a8ea31a
address
ltc1qtrnttjxaeq7ktgnt6guwgznnysagagc672egl5
transaction
ec8b51d54a63626f968a8b91e22354063bc90ff9d1d66db47eacc8c9a4bf76d2
spent
true